Ulysses S. Grant Elementary School opened in 1910. It is designated as a local historical site.

The Grant mascot is the Generals.

The school colors are royal blue and gold.

The 2009-10 enrollment at Grant is 302. Grant has students from 27 different countries.

Grant Mission:
In a cooperative effort with parents and the community, Grant School seeks to help all children reach their academic, intellectual, social, and creative potential within a safe and nurturing environment.

School Pledge:
As a Grant All Star, I promise to be: Safe, A Team Player, A Learner, Respectful, and Responsible. I believe, I'll achieve it! All Star!
